git: openjdk/jdk-sandbox: jep486: 2 new changesets

duke duke at openjdk.org
Wed Oct 30 18:35:27 UTC 2024


Changeset: 16709075
Branch: jep486
Author:    Stuart Marks <stuart.marks at oracle.com>
Date:      2024-10-30 09:05:37 +0000
URL:       https://git.openjdk.org/jdk-sandbox/commit/167090754cc2766fe7c8c839e02bf033e8024454

Remove two obsolete RMI tests:
 - test/jdk/java/rmi/server/RMIClassLoader/spi/ContextInsulation.java
 - test/jdk/sun/rmi/transport/tcp/disableMultiplexing/DisableMultiplexing.java
Adjust two tests to run without the Security Manager:
 - test/jdk/java/rmi/server/RMIClassLoader/loadProxyClasses/LoadProxyClasses.java
 - test/jdk/java/rmi/server/RMIClassLoader/spi/DefaultProperty.java
Remove all of these tests from the problem list.

! test/jdk/ProblemList.txt
! test/jdk/java/rmi/server/RMIClassLoader/loadProxyClasses/LoadProxyClasses.java
- test/jdk/java/rmi/server/RMIClassLoader/loadProxyClasses/security.policy
- test/jdk/java/rmi/server/RMIClassLoader/spi/ContextInsulation.java
! test/jdk/java/rmi/server/RMIClassLoader/spi/DefaultProperty.java
- test/jdk/sun/rmi/transport/tcp/disableMultiplexing/DisableMultiplexing.java
- test/jdk/sun/rmi/transport/tcp/disableMultiplexing/DisableMultiplexing_Stub.java

Changeset: 3fe3f598
Branch: jep486
Author:    Stuart Marks <stuart.marks at oracle.com>
Date:      2024-10-30 10:29:48 +0000
URL:       https://git.openjdk.org/jdk-sandbox/commit/3fe3f598b9d3b2a1e9e37b0c588e253ae019c7b7

Modify three RMI tests to work without the security manager:
 - test/jdk/java/rmi/registry/classPathCodebase/ClassPathCodebase.java
 - test/jdk/java/rmi/registry/readTest/CodebaseTest.java
 - test/jdk/java/rmi/server/RMIClassLoader/useCodebaseOnly/UseCodebaseOnly.java
Also remove them from the problem list.

! test/jdk/ProblemList.txt
! test/jdk/java/rmi/registry/classPathCodebase/ClassPathCodebase.java
- test/jdk/java/rmi/registry/classPathCodebase/registry.security.policy
- test/jdk/java/rmi/registry/classPathCodebase/security.policy
! test/jdk/java/rmi/registry/readTest/CodebaseTest.java
- test/jdk/java/rmi/registry/readTest/registry.security.policy
! test/jdk/java/rmi/server/RMIClassLoader/useCodebaseOnly/UseCodebaseOnly.java
- test/jdk/java/rmi/server/RMIClassLoader/useCodebaseOnly/security.policy
+ test/jdk/java/rmi/testlibrary/TestLoaderHandler.java



More information about the jdk-sandbox-changes mailing list